If I remember correctly the train ride to DLP was 45 minutes, maybe an hour, from downtown Paris which is where we stayed. We basically just picked a day to go and then purchased our round trip train tickets from the terminal that day. We arrived at DLP and bought our tickets at the gate...that was it. Those were the days before knowing about these boards or before we were obsessed with the internet and planning. It was all very spur-of-the moment once we booked the trip to Paris and very casual. At that time there were no kids, just four adults. We did all of our getting around via the subway and train systems with the exception of Normandy. That was a full day bus trip that was scheduled in advance. We looked at the different subway and train maps, knew where we wanted to go then figured out the best way to get there. If we figured out how to get around I'm sure anyone could!
If you found a package through Travelzoo you could choose a hotel in downtown Paris and keep the room for the week. If you wanted to stay one night at DLP you could pack an overnight bag, take the train there, stay one night then return to downtown Paris at your other hotel. The package prices through Travelzoo are so incredible that it might be worthwhile.
